== Latin ==
=== Etymology ===
Borrowed from Ancient Greek στόμωμα (stómōma).
=== Pronunciation ===
(Classical Latin) IPA(key): [stɔˈmoː.ma]
(modern Italianate Ecclesiastical) IPA(key): [stoˈmɔː.ma]
=== Noun ===
stomōma n (genitive stomōmatis); third declension
fine scales which fly off in hammering
==== Declension ====
Third-declension noun (neuter, imparisyllabic non-i-stem).
